Koelreuteria elegans, commonly known as Flamegold, is a deciduous tree celebrated for its bright yellow summer flowers and distinctive lantern-like seed pods.

Prefers full sun for best flowering.
Tolerates partial shade.
Water regularly, allowing soil to dry slightly between waterings.
Reduce in winter.
Well-draining soil. Tolerates a range of soil types, including sandy, loamy, and clay soils.
Thrives in warm temperatures.
Ideal growing range 18-27°C.
Outdoor
Feed in early spring with a balanced, slow-release fertilizer.
Avoid over-fertilizing.
